Off-highway OEMs historically have utilized simple 1-Dimensional analyses (either themselves or through their cooling system suppliers) to predict the cooling performance of each vehicle's engine system. These analyses produce a low accuracy rate, which often results in late design changes leading to delays in the overall project.

To improve this situation, manufacturers have a tool at their disposal in computational fluid dynamics (CFD). Using inputs of temperatures, flows, restrictions, heat transfer ability of coolers, and 3-Dimensional models of vehicle architecture, a 3D prediction of the cooling performance can be achieved. The 3D prediction results in an overall systems design with a higher success rate during validation.
